Volkswagen E-Golf
MOT data from 10,892 tests in 2024. Pass rate: 90.4%. Average mileage at test: 34,174 miles.
Common failure reasons
| Reason | Count |
|---|---|
| a tyre seriously damaged | 355 |
| a tyre cords visible or damaged | 318 |
| tyre tread depth not in accordance with the requirements | 159 |
| a shock absorber damaged to the extent that it does not function or showing signs of severe leakage | 152 |
| windscreen washers not working or not providing sufficient fluid to clear the windscreen | 39 |
| wiper blade missing or obviously not clearing the windscreen | 37 |
| a tyre has a lump, bulge or tear caused by separation or partial failure of its structure. this includes any lifting of the tread rubber | 25 |
| wiper blade defective | 16 |
| a wheel with a loose or missing wheel nut, bolt or stud | 16 |
| the aim of a headlamp is not within limits laid down in the requirements | 15 |
